In the rapidly advancing life science fields, endpoint polymerase chain reaction (PCR), real-time PCR (qPCR), and digital PCR (dPCR) have become indispensable tools that complement one another across a variety of applications. These three PCR technologies each offer unique strengths and capabilities that make them essential for modern research. These PCR technologies are complementary, each contributing critical value depending on the research needs at hand.
Endpoint PCR continues to be a reliable, straightforward method for qualitative analysis, offering cost-effective solutions for amplifying or detecting the presence of specific genes. Real-time PCR adds quantitative power, allowing researchers to measure gene expression levels with precision and speed. Zooming in even further, digital PCR provides absolute quantification, enabling researchers to detect low-abundance targets and rare genetic variations with unparalleled sensitivity and accuracy.
